Professor Sir Hilary Beckles honoured by American Peers
The UWI Regional Headquarters, Jamaica W.I. Wednesday, January 25, 2023—The American Historical Association has voted to select Vice-Chancellor of The University of the West Indies (The UWI), Professor Sir Hilary Beckles as its Honorary Foreign Scholar for 2023.
